Corin Frei, Alster Shipyard
11th April 827 A.S.

A great day for Rheinland and her people.

Everyone now agrees that the military coup d'etat in Rheinland brought many people together; Bretonians and Imperials under a common master, but most importantly an Alliance between Republican Shipping and the Unioners.

It was not an easy task.

In case you don't remember, the Unioner undisputed leader, Corin Frei, has been hiding the last few days while his men have been sacrificing their lives to put the Emperor on His golden throne.

During the anniversary of the Unioner Gas Attack on Alster Shipyard, where hundreds of workers were choked to death in a vigorous display of Unioner power, Corin Frei visited the station in his first public appearance in order to sign an Alliance with the Republican CEO. Analysts agree that he couldn't have chosen a better timing for this historical agreement.

The chemistry between the two men was obvious from the beginning. The Republican CEO lavished Frei with praises and monetary "gifts" but while the Unioner boss was about to present his own gift, a ship full of gas passed outside Alster Shipyard. Terror grippled the entire Republican delegation before it was revealed that it was just a harmless ship carrying H-fuel.

In his speech, the Republican CEO underlined the "core values that Republican Shipping has always shared with the Empire" before noting that "my Unioner allies couldn't have chosen a better moment to visit Alster". Corin Frei tried to give a speech as well but he had too many drinks already so instead he exclaimed "Brothers in Gas!" to underline the unbreakable bond and history that the two factions will always share.

The Emperor from his Imperial Palace in New London was reportedly very pleased as He decreed that Republican convoys will now be protected exclusively by Unioner ships while the architect of this agreement, Corin Frei, would now serve as the Imperial court jester.

It is a very sad day for House Rheinland.

The restoration of the Rheinlandic Empire means that the Rheinlanders haven't leard from their past errors and mistakes. Allow me to refresh everyone's memory:

- Was it not the Rheinland Empire who ignited the 80-Years War with the GMG, soundly losing the war itself? Back in 800 AS, the very memorial to the Empire's greatest failure was the remains of their majestic fleet in ruins within the Yanagi Pocket, in Sigma-13 - cleared as of today;

- Was it not the Empire that plunged House Rheinland in a sea of debts as the result of losing the aforementioned 80-Years War, which brought to the sale of Planet Stuttgart to Synth Foods?

- Was it not the Empire, through the infamously known Chancellor Niemann, which ignited the Nomad War of 800-801 AS and invaded neighbouring Kusari in an attempt - of course failed and foiled - to succeed where others didn't?

- Was it not the Empire which left House Rheinland, once a glorious and feared House, broken and in ruins in a way even worse than the 80-Years War's aftermath, its military being the laughing joke of all bars from all over Sirius?

And what about the prisoners of this civil war? Is it really true that those who supported the Federal Government along with political dissidents and anti-Imperial contesters will be rounded up and transported to Vierlande Prison to be forever jailed under Unioner eyes?

And let's not forget the Unioners - Sirius' biggest epitome of ignorant, backstabbing hypocrites. At first, they oppose and strike the corporations without discrimination, then they bend their knee to them, licking their boots and doing their dirty job while their so-called 'mastermind', the biggest ignorant hypocrite of the bunch, that pansy known as basks at the top of Imperial society, never a day he passed with dirt on his pristine hands.

This is not my House Rheinland. This is not our House Rheinland. The House Rheinland we know would never bend its knee to imperialists, emperors and dictators, lest we fall in the errors of our predecessors!
